*** BioArray Solutions Assigned Patent ALEXANDRIA, Va., June 29 -- BioArray Solutions, Warren, N.J., has been assigned a patent (7,970,553) developed by Michael Seul, Fanwood, N.J., Tatiana Vener, Stirling, N.J., and Xiongwu Xia, Irvine, Calif., for a "concurrent optimization in selection of primer and capture probe sets for nucleic acid analysis." The abstract of the patent published by the U.S. Patent and Trademark Office states: "Disclosed is a method of iteratively optimizing two (or more) interrelated sets of probes for the multi-step analysis of sets of designated sequences, each such sequence requiring, for conversion, at least one conversion probe ("primer"), and each converted sequence requiring, for detection, at least one capture probe. The iterative method disclosed herein for the concurrent optimization of primer and probe selection invokes fast logical string matching functions to perform a complete cross-correlation of probe sequences and target sequences. The score function assigns to each probe-target alignment a "degree of matching" score on the basis of position-weighted Hamming distance functions introduced herein. Pairs of probes in the final selection may differ in several positions, while other pairs of probes may differ in only a single position. Not all such positions are of equal importance, and a score function is introduced, reflecting the position of the mismatch within the probe sequence." The patent application was filed on July 14, 2009 (12/502,725). *** Ethicon Assigned Patent ALEXANDRIA, Va., June 30 -- Ethicon, Somerville, N.J., has been assigned a patent (7,970,478) developed by Stephen Wahlgren, Easton, Pa., and Michael R. Tracey, Branchburg, N.J., for an "optimizing stimulation therapy of an external stimulating device based on firing of action potential in target nerve." The abstract of the patent published by the U.S. Patent and Trademark Office states: "A method and system for optimizing stimulation therapy of an external stimulating device. The stimulating signal for stimulation of a target nerve is produced using the external stimulating device. A magnetic field is induced in an implanted transmitting coil disposed proximate the target nerve when the action potential is fired along an axon of the target nerve. In turn, a feedback signal is generated in a receiving coil associated with the external stimulating device based on whether the target nerve fires an action potential. Stimulating signal parameters of the stimulating signal are adjusted based on the feedback signal." The patent application was filed on Dec. 19, 2008 (12/317,194). *** AT&T Intellectual Property II Assigned Patent for Method for Call Forwarding a Call from a Mobile Telephone ALEXANDRIA, Va., June 30 -- AT&T Intellectual Property II, Atlanta, has been assigned a patent (7,970,392) developed by four co-inventors for a "method for call forwarding a call from a mobile telephone." The co-inventors are Barry S. Bosik, Marlboro, N.J., James Ehlinger, Colts Neck, N.J., Amit Garg, Howell, N.J., and Rajeev B. Patil, Holmdel, N.J.

The abstract of the patent published by the U.S. Patent and Trademark Office states: "A method of call forwarding a call originally placed to a mobile telephone number of a mobile telephone to a landline telephone number of a landline telephone is provided, wherein the call is routed through a telephone network by a service provider. A forwarding location of the mobile telephone is determined using a mobile location technology. The landline telephone number of the landline telephone is provided to the service provider. A current mobile telephone location is determined by a mobile location technology. The mobile location technology is capable of locating the mobile telephone using service provider equipment. The service provider determines that the call is being made to the mobile telephone when the current mobile telephone location is at the forwarding location. The call to the mobile telephone number is forwarded to the landline telephone number when the current mobile telephone location is at the forwarding location." The patent application was filed on Oct. 20, 2009 (12/589,241). *** Alcatel-Lucent USA Assigned Patent for Push-to-talk Group Call System using CDMA 1x-EVDO Cellular Network ALEXANDRIA, Va., June 30 -- Alcatel-Lucent USA, Murray Hill, N.J., has been assigned a patent (7,970,425) developed by Krishna Balachandran, Morganville, N.J., Kenneth C. Budka, Marlboro, N.J., and Joseph H. Kang, Belle Mead, N.J., for a "push-to-talk group call system using CDMA 1x-EVDO cellular network." The abstract of the patent published by the U.S. Patent and Trademark Office states: "A push-to-talk ("PTT") group call system, for use as, e.g., a public safety wireless network, includes a CDMA-based 1x-EVDO radio access network operably connected to a PTT server over an IP network. The radio access network includes base stations for radio communications with a number of distributed mobile stations. In carrying out wireless communications, the group call system combines IP-based voice and other real-time multimedia services with the 1x-EVDO radio access network's Broadcast Multicast Service. This allows a number of users to receive the same copy of an IP-based media stream for point-to-multipoint, group transmissions. To reduce call setup times, the group call system uses "standing" call groups, which are ongoing group communication channels pre-established between the PTT server and authorized group users. Thus, mobile stations link to one or more standing call groups of interest upon power-up, prior to users speaking." The patent application was filed on Aug. 30, 2005 (11/215,669). *** Cellco Partnership Assigned Patent ALEXANDRIA, Va., June 30 -- Cellco Partnership, Basking Ridge, N.J., has been assigned a patent (7,970,414) developed by Steven Werden, Bridgewater, N.J., Iftekhar Rahman, Billerica, Mass., and John Seeman, Hillsborough, N.J., for a "system and method for providing assisted GPS location service to dual mode mobile station." The abstract of the patent published by the U.S. Patent and Trademark Office states: "A system for determining position of a mobile station is provided. The mobile station is equipped with a GPS receiver for receiving satellite signals from satellites. The system comprises a wireless wide area network (WWAN) configured to provide an acquisition assistance data for use in acquiring the satellite signals by the GPS receiver to the mobile station that is operable in the WWAN. A position determination entity (PDE) is provided to determine position of the mobile station based on the satellite signals received sent from the mobile station and the acquisition assistance data from the WWAN. A wireless local area network (WLAN) provides RF signals to the mobile station when the mobile station enters into a WLAN area. The mobile station determines the position of the mobile station using the WWAN transceiver and the GPS receiver at the time when the mobile station enters into the WLAN area. The MS then uses this position when it is operating in the WLAN and it is requested to provide location by a LBS application or by the emergency 911 calling service." The patent application was filed on April 24, 2008 (12/081,968). *** Siemens Medical Solutions USA Assigned Patent ALEXANDRIA, Va., June 30 -- Siemens Medical Solutions USA, Malvern, Pa., has been assigned a patent (7,970,191) developed by five co-inventors for a "system and method for simultaneously subsampling fluoroscopic images and enhancing guidewire visibility." The co-inventors are Bogdan Georgescu, Plainsboro, N.J., Peter Durlak, Erlangen, Germany, Vassilis Athitsos, Arlington, Texas, Adrian Barbu, Tallahassee, Fla., and Dorin Comaniciu, Princeton Junction, N.J.

The abstract of the patent published by the U.S. Patent and Trademark Office states: "A method for downsampling fluoroscopic images and enhancing guidewire visibility during coronary angioplasty includes providing a first digitized image, filtering the image with one or more steerable filters of different angular orientations, assigning a weight W and orientation O for each pixel based on the filter response for each pixel, wherein each pixel weight is assigned to a function of a maximum filter response magnitude and the pixel orientation is calculated from the angle producing the maximum filter response if the magnitude is greater than zero, wherein guidewire pixels have a higher weight than non-guidewire pixels, and downsampling the orientation and weights to calculate a second image of half the resolution of the first image, wherein the downsampling accounts for the orientation and higher weight assigned to the guidewire pixels." The patent application was filed on Sept. 25, 2007 (11/860,591). *** Google Assigned Patent for Entity Type Assignment ALEXANDRIA, Va., June 30 -- Google, Mountain View, Calif., has been assigned a patent (7,970,766) developed by four co-inventors for an entity type assignment. The co-inventors are Farhan Shamsi, Rego Park, N.Y., Alex Kehlenbeck, New York, David Vespe, New York, and Nemanja Petrovic, Plainsboro, N.J.

The abstract of the patent published by the U.S. Patent and Trademark Office states: "A repository contains objects including facts about entities. Objects may be of known or unknown entity type. An entity type assignment engine assigns entity types to objects of unknown entity type. A feature generation module generates a set of features describing the facts included with each object in the repository. An entity type model module generates an entity type model based on the sets of features generated for a subset of objects. An entity type model module generates entity type models, such as a classifier or generative models, based on the sets of features associated with objects of known entity type. An entity type assignment module generates a value based on the sets of features associated with an object of unknown entity type and the entity type model. This value indicates whether the object of unknown entity type is of a known entity type. An object update module stores the object to which the known entity type was assigned in the repository in association with the assigned entity type." The patent application was filed on July 23, 2007 (11/781,891).
